High chromium irons description high chromium irons provide excellent erosion resistance and a reasonable degree of corrosion resistance due to their high alloy content, thus surpassing all other cast irons for use in aggressive services. Their exceptional wear resistance is the result of their high carbide content, which forms along with austenite during solidification as a proeutectic or eutectic phase depending on alloy composition, and particularly depending upon carbon and chromium content.
